The global market for Autoclaved Aerated Concrete (AAC) was estimated to be worth US$ 5453 million in 2024 and is forecast to a readjusted size of US$ 7971 million by 2031 with a CAGR of 5.5% during the forecast period 2025-2031.

Autoclaved Aerated Concrete (AAC) is a lightweight, precast building material made from natural raw materials such as sand, cement, lime, and aluminum powder. This material is aerated through a chemical reaction, resulting in a porous structure with excellent thermal insulation properties. AAC is commonly used in construction for walls, floors, and roofs due to its lightweight nature, thermal efficiency, and sound insulation capabilities.
Market Drivers for Autoclaved Aerated Concrete (AAC)
Sustainable Building Practices:
Driver: Increasing focus on sustainable construction practices and environmental conservation drives the demand for AAC, which is eco-friendly, energy-efficient, and reduces the carbon footprint of buildings.
Energy Efficiency and Thermal Insulation:
Driver: AAC's excellent thermal insulation properties help reduce energy consumption for heating and cooling, making it a popular choice for energy-efficient buildings and green construction projects.
Construction Speed and Ease of Installation:
Driver: AAC blocks are lightweight and easy to handle, leading to faster construction times and reduced labor costs, making it an attractive option for efficient building projects.
Fire Resistance and Durability:
Driver: AAC offers high fire resistance, durability, and resistance to pests and mold, making it a durable and long-lasting building material suitable for various construction applications.
Noise Reduction and Comfort:
Driver: AAC's sound insulation properties contribute to a quieter and more comfortable indoor environment, appealing to homeowners and developers looking to enhance building acoustics.
Market Challenges for Autoclaved Aerated Concrete (AAC)
Awareness and Education:
Challenge: Lack of awareness among builders, architects, and consumers about the benefits and applications of AAC can hinder its widespread adoption, requiring education and promotion efforts.
Supply Chain and Availability:
Challenge: Limited availability of AAC materials in some regions and challenges in the supply chain can impact the accessibility and affordability of AAC for construction projects.
Structural Design Considerations:
Challenge: Design considerations such as load-bearing capacity, connection details, and compatibility with other building materials need to be carefully addressed to ensure the structural integrity of AAC constructions.
Cost Competitiveness:
Challenge: Initial costs of AAC materials and construction may be higher compared to traditional building materials, potentially posing a challenge in competitive pricing and market adoption.
Regulatory Compliance and Standards:
Challenge: Compliance with building codes, standards, and regulations specific to AAC constructions can present challenges, requiring adherence to quality control measures and certification processes.
